Learn English Feel Good

Creator: learnenglishfeelgood.com | visit site

Grade Range: K - 7

This site offers help with curricular needs of ESL/ELL students. From grammar to pronunciation to vocabulary assists, this site offers whatever you might need. Extra exercises are available in the areas ESL/ELL teachers need the most: grammar exercises, vocabulary tests, listening and video clips, idioms and phrasal verbs, and content based practice. Although the site contains a lot of ads, and one small optional section requires payment, it is very easy to use and search. Beginners’ exercises include prompts from their first languages of Spanish and French.

In the Classroom

Share this link on your class website for students to access both in and out of the classroom. After students view one of the video clips from this site, have them select their own favorite movie section and create similar questions and other evaluative activities for the class. Challenge students to create their own videos to share using a tool such as TeacherTube <a href="/single.cfm?id=9419">reviewed here</a>. Some of the activities may also be appropriate to reinforce grammar skills for learning support and struggling students for whom English is their native language.
